
Over a two-month period, contributed backend and blockchain integration work to the wormhole-foundation/wormhole repository, focusing on network configuration and operational reliability. Developed and deployed Ink testnet support by updating Go services to register and configure the Ink network, enabling end-to-end monitoring and interaction workflows for robust testnet QA and future multi-network deployments. Utilized Go and Protocol Buffers to implement environment configuration and chain ID integration. Additionally, audited and updated guardian node chain ID mappings to align with live network changes, reducing misconfigurations and streamlining onboarding or deprecation of supported chains. Work emphasized maintainability and accurate cross-chain operations.
